A Glimpse at Grand Prairie: Historical Context and Urban Growth

Founded in the late 19th century and officially incorporated in 1909, Grand Prairie has steadily transformed from a modest railroad town into a thriving suburbia with a robust local economy. As part of the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ington metroplex, it benefits from proximity to major economic engines while retaining a unique community character. The city’s population has grown significantly, surpassing 200,000 residents, and its landscape is punctuated by ambitious civic developments, attracting residents and businesses alike by investing in quality-of-life enhancements and modern amenities.

Epic Waters Grand Prairie: An Overview of the Indoor Waterpark

Inaugurated in 2018, Epic Waters Grand Prairie is often termed “the cruise ship on land.” This expansive, climate-controlled indoor waterpark spans more than 80,000 square feet and remains open year-round, offering residents and tourists a dynamic destination for family fun in Grand Prairie. As one of the largest indoor waterparks in Texas, it features an array of state-of-the-art attractions, which not only enhance the city’s leisure landscape but also serve as a driving force for tourism and economic development.

Signature Waterpark Attractions Overview

Epic Waters Grand Prairie boasts a unique selection of water slides, pools, and activity zones tailored for all ages and thrill levels:

  • Largest Indoor AquaLoop in the U.S.: The “Lasso Loop” challenges visitors with its steep drop and high-speed loops.
  • Rio Grand Lazy River: The longest indoor lazy river in Texas, providing relaxation and scenic enjoyment for families.
  • Rascal’s Round Up: A multi-level interactive children’s play structure complete with slides, sprayers, and tipping buckets designed for younger visitors.
  • Surf Simulator: The FlowRider surf machine caters to both novices and experienced surfers, offering lessons and open sessions.
  • Indoor Wave Pool: Mimics the feel of ocean waves, giving swimmers a real taste of aquatic adventure.

Each waterpark attraction is designed with safety and accessibility in mind, reflecting the city’s broader mission of fostering inclusive, all-season recreation.

Family Fun in Grand Prairie: Programming and Community Engagement

Epic Waters Grand Prairie goes beyond water attractions by offering robust programming for community health and family engagement. The waterpark frequently organizes themed nights, youth and adult swimming lessons, aquatic fitness classes, and special events such as birthday parties and group retreats. These initiatives have fostered a strong sense of community, making family fun in Grand Prairie accessible and central to local life.

Furthermore, as part of a broader municipal complex, Epic Waters is near “The Epic,” a 120,000-square-foot advanced recreation and arts center. Together, these facilities embody Grand Prairie’s civic vision for comprehensive, multigenerational recreation. This integrated approach amplifies the city’s appeal as a center for both residents and visitors seeking quality experiences.

Sustainability and Social Responsibility

Modern civic development in Grand Prairie, Texas, places an emphasis on sustainability. Epic Waters Grand Prairie was designed to maximize energy efficiency with LED lighting, advanced climate control, and water recycling systems, aligning with the city’s environmental stewardship goals. The park’s construction utilized sustainable materials and incorporated design elements that minimize carbon footprint, demonstrating a forward-thinking approach consistent with Texas’s evolving environmental standards.

Additionally, accessibility features ensure that guests with disabilities can fully enjoy the facilities. The City of Grand Prairie’s focus on inclusivity aligns with federal ADA (Americans with Disabilities Act) recommendations, and the facility’s popularity serves as evidence of its widespread community acceptance (ADA.gov).

Urban Connectivity: Transportation and Regional Integration

Grand Prairie’s strategic location has facilitated rapid access to Epic Waters Grand Prairie from various parts of Texas and the United States. Major highways such as Interstate 30 and State Highway 161 offer visitors easy routes from Dallas, Fort Worth, and surrounding suburbs. The city’s ongoing investment in transportation infrastructure underpins the accessibility and continued success of modern civic developments by connecting residents and tourists with downtown attractions and recreational facilities.
